NZ Rural After-Hours Primary Care Provider Survey
The New Zealand Rural General Practice Network (NZRGPN) commissioned a survey examining rural health practitioners' viewpoints about providing after-hours primary care. The survey was conducted by Dr Ron Janes.
Providers were asked to complete an anonymous questionnaire over the Internet that asked for their experiences and views about providing after-hours oncall care. The results of the survey have been released as three papers.
